In general, the protocol includes:
The Notice Letter is provided two weeks in advance of a formal monitoring and two workdays in advance of follow up monitoring. The Notice Letter identifies the contracts that will be included in the monitoring, informs the contractor of the dates, verifies the location of the monitoring and lists documents and other information needed at the conclusion of the entrance conference.
The Entrance Conference establishes the purpose of the review, identifies key contact persons, provides the contractor an opportunity to present an agency overview and concludes with a review of DADS access to documents and information needed to complete the monitoring. The Entrance Conference includes a roster that is signed by each person who attends the entrance conference. A copy of the Entrance Conference is provided to the contractor.
The Exit Conference provides the results of the monitoring, identifies required actions, explains the process to request an administrative review and/or administrative hearing and informs the contractor that the contractor may submit a management response to DADS regarding the monitoring results within three work days from the date of the exit conference. The Exit Conference includes a roster that is signed by each person who attends the exit conference. A copy of the Exit Conference is provided to the contractor.
